File An Insurance Claim

You know that homeowner's insurance that you pay every month? It's actually good for some things, and floods are usually one of them. Depending on the area of the country you live in, and the exact policy you have, your homeowner's insurance may cover basement floods. The amount of your deductible will help you determine if it makes financial sense to file an insurance claim or if you should just deal with everything on your own. When filing an insurance claim, make sure that you take pictures of the damage or that they have an insurance adjuster to come by and take photos-- that way your insurance agency can get an accurate depiction of just how extensive the flood damage is. 

Call A Water Damage Restoration Company

If your basement floor only requires a roll of paper towels and a mop, then you are golden. If, however, the water damage is a bit more extensive, then you may need the help of a water damage restoration company. A water damage restoration company can help with a variety of things, including the cleanup after the flood and ensuring that everything is properly taken care of so that no further damage takes place. For instance, if your drywall was ruined, a water damage restoration company will help to not only inspect your drywall but take it out and clean out any mold behind it, preventing you from having a larger problem to deal with further on down the line.
